WebFirst, test your home radon level. The Environmental Protection Agency (EPA) recommends contacting a qualified professional to install a radon reduction (also called radon mitigation) system if your home radon level is at or above 4 pCi/L of air. These are fixes to your home to lower the radon level. WebIt’s important to test your home for radon to ensure the levels are safe. A radon level of 4 picoCuries per liter (pCi/L) or more is considered high.
